There are 3 'tiers' of spawns on each half of the map. The spawns don't really push back like you are describing, they just 'are'. If one team pushes too close to the spawns, it flips which team is spawning on what half. The main reason the reason why so many of the maps in this game are so bad is because so many of the maps have chokepoints well outside the invisible line the game uses to determine spawn flips. So spawns like Ramaza A spawn or Aniya Palace E-side uncap, or Grazna raid C side are absolutely miserable against a team that is smart enough to hold 2 points and then just hang back and control the choke points.

Ramaza A & Aniya E are the grossest offenders because they have, literally, 3 small chokepoints that exit their spawn and they are all able to be covered from high ground with hard cover. It is insane that someone who designs video game maps for a living looked at that layout and said "this is good, ship it."

Always rush the bridge at either spawn point. I run with a pistol/knife secondary to run faster. Use nades/c4 to clear out the flag if you see it capping. I like to wrap around the bus on the first cap attempt. Just be ready to shoot.

Use smokes to cover your path to the stairs if you fail on the first attempt. Ladders always an option, I usually take the stairs though.

Retaking it is one of the funnest parts of the bridge. Learn to use and switch out multiple loadouts depending on the situation.

Bridge map owns
